Description

A kind of Novel spraying machine
Technical field
This utility model relates to a kind of Novel spraying machine, belongs to the technical field of construction material construction machinery.
Background technology
Flush coater is a kind of new and effective construction machinery, and this equipment, by driving machinery by slurry pressurization, through conveying pipe, spray gun, the ejection of nozzle moment, expands rapidly, is atomized, form coating being sprayed-on surface.This equipment is applied when mortar plastering operation, and coat of plaster cohesive force is strong, is difficult to hollowing cracking, and efficiency of construction is high, and labor intensity is low.When this equipment uses piston-driven machine tool, slurry is easily formed pulse at nozzle, affects coating quality, and existing pulp feeder mode exists open defect, it is therefore proposed that this utility model.

Detailed description of the invention
Below in conjunction with specific embodiment, this utility model is further described, but protection domain of the present utility model is not limited to this.
Embodiment 1
As described in Fig. 1-3, Novel spraying machine of the present utility model, including housing 1, driving means and piston mechanism 4, driving means includes reciprocating drive mechanism, rotary drive mechanism and drive mechanism, one end of drive mechanism is connected with reciprocating drive mechanism and rotary drive mechanism, and the other end of drive mechanism is connected with piston mechanism 4;Reciprocating drive mechanism drive transmission device does axially reciprocating, and rotary drive mechanism drive transmission device rotates.
Drive mechanism in the present embodiment 1 includes reciprocating drive axle 2 and rotary motion power transmission shaft 16, and rotary motion power transmission shaft 16 is sleeved in reciprocating motion rotary shaft 2, and rotary motion power transmission shaft 16 is provided with mixing component 3.
Mixing component 3 in the present embodiment 1 can be the combination of helical blade type, oar blade type or helical blade type and oar blade type.
Driving means in the present embodiment 1 includes reducing motor 5 and drives bent axle 17.Rotary drive mechanism includes gear 1, gear 28, bevel gear 1 and bevel gear 2 10, gear 1 is arranged on driving bent axle 17, gear 28 engages with gear 1, bevel gear 1 and gear 28 are installed on the same axis, bevel gear 2 10 is arranged on rotary motion power transmission shaft 16, and bevel gear 2 10 engages with bevel gear 1.
Reciprocating drive mechanism includes connecting rod 18 and swing arm 6, connecting rod 18 one end is connected with driving bent axle 17, the other end is connected with swing arm 6, one end of swing arm 6 is flexibly connected with housing 1, the other end of swing arm 6 is connected by ball bearing 61 with reciprocating drive axle 2, it is slotted hole that swing arm 6 is connected the perforate of end with reciprocating drive axle 2, ball bearing 61 is arranged in slotted hole, and ball bearing 61 can do radial motion in slotted hole, can effectively slow down the circular runout of reciprocating drive axle 2, thus reduce the abrasion of piston, increase the service life.
The import department of housing 1 is provided with vibrosieve 11, and vibrosieve 11 is positioned at the top of reciprocating drive axle 2, prevents bulky grain mortar from falling into during charging.The bottom of housing 1 is provided with slurry outlet 12.
This utility model also includes spraying air pump 14 and oil supply system 15, and spraying air pump 14 is for atomized slurry, and oil supply system 15 is for the fuel feeding to driving means.
As shown in Figure 4, the piston mechanism 4 of the present embodiment 1, including the piston 42 being arranged in cylinder body 41, cylinder body 41 connects discharge component, and discharge component connects buffer gear.
Buffer gear in the present embodiment 1 includes sealing bolster 43; it not only acts as the effect of buffering; has Packed function simultaneously; seal to connect on bolster 43 and have spring 1 and spring 2 45; spring 1 connects travel switch 46; action shut down, have pressure big time Concatenate shut-down function, spring 2 45 play buffering slurry pulsation effect.
Discharge component in the present embodiment 1 includes discharge nozzle 47, spheroid 1 and spheroid 2 49 are installed in discharge nozzle 47, this spheroid 1 and spheroid 2 49 are with piston 42 action, vacuum principle is utilized to carry out feeding discharging, during feeding, spheroid 1 seals discharging opening, during discharging, spheroid 2 49 seals material taking mouth, and the top of spheroid 1 and spheroid 2 49 is equipped with limited block 410, and spheroid 1 and spheroid 2 49 are limited to certain zone of action.
Buffer gear is positioned at the top of discharge nozzle 47, and the buffer gear in the present embodiment 1 is vertical with discharge nozzle 47.
Embodiment 2
Buffer gear in the present embodiment 2 is with discharge nozzle 47 in the same horizontal line.
Other parts of the present embodiment 2 and connected mode thereof, operation principle are the most same as in Example 1, do not repeat.
When this utility model uses, from mortar import, mortar is inputted in housing 1, then by the reciprocating motion of reciprocating drive axle 2, mortar is delivered to mortar outlet tube from mortar outlet 12, finally sends from mortar outlet tube 13.
Novel spraying machine of the present utility model, the reciprocatory movement of its drive disk assembly drives piston mechanism 4 to carry mortar, and the rotary movement of self drives mixing component 3 to realize the stirring to slurry and Homogeneous charge;Buffer gear 4 effectively eliminates spraying pulse, it is ensured that the uniformity of spraying, improves coating quality.Meanwhile, the pressure limit mechanism on buffer gear, the Concatenate shut-down under discharge pressure overrun condition can be realized, it is ensured that work safety.
